Menu Close

Cape Town: Senior Python Developer – Software Development – R1.44M – R960K posted by Hire Resolve

Senior Python Developer – Software Development – R1.44M – R960K

Posted on 2025-04-28 00:01:22

Company Hire Resolve
Salary 0
Category Other IT/Computer
Location South Africa  /  Western Cape  /  Cape Town

Job Summary

Hire Resolves client is urgently seeking the expertise of a Senior Python Developer in Cape Town (Hybrid)

 

Responsibilities

  • Design, develop, and maintain robust and scalable Python-based applications, tools, and frameworks that integrate machine learning models and algorithms
  • Collaborate with data scientists and engineers to implement end-to-end machine learning pipelines, from data preprocessing and feature engineering to model training, evaluation, and deployment
  • Utilise your expertise in PySpark to process and analyse large volumes of data efficiently and develop performant data pipelines
  • Leverage Kubernetes for container orchestration, deployment, and scaling of applications.
  • Contribute to the architecture and design of data-driven solutions, ensuring they meet both functional and non-functional requirements
  • Optimise and refactor existing code to enhance performance, maintainability, and reusability
  • Stay current with the latest advancements in machine learning, Python development, big data technologies, Kubernetes, and apply this knowledge to enhance team capabilities
  • Mentor and provide guidance to junior developers, assisting them in skill development and project execution
  • Participate in code reviews, providing constructive feedback and ensuring adherence to coding standards

Requirements

  • Bachelors or Masters degree in Computer Science, Engineering, or a related field
  • Proven experience as a Python Developer with a strong understanding of Python programming concepts and best practices
  • Demonstrated expertise in developing machine learning solutions, including feature selection, model training, and evaluation
  • Hands-on experience with PySpark and the ability to develop efficient data processing pipelines.
  • Familiarity with distributed computing frameworks, big data technologies, and Kubernetes for container orchestration
  • Proficiency in data manipulation libraries (e.g., Pandas, NumPy) and machine learning frameworks (e.g., Scikit-learn, TensorFlow, PyTorch)
  • Strong problem-solving skills and the ability to analyze complex technical issues
  • Experience working in an Agile/Scrum development environment
  • Excellent communication skills and the ability to work collaboratively in cross-functional teams
  • A proactive and self-driven attitude with a passion for staying updated with industry trends
  • Solid SQL (ANSI preferably Microsoft T-SQL) experience including the ability to work with complex queries
  • Solid Knowledge of dimensional modelling (Kimble)
  • Solid knowledge of RDBMS architecture
  • Solid knowledge of OLTP and OLAP concepts
  • Good knowledge of data integration concepts (ETL / ELT)
  • Good knowledge of database management especially pertaining to permissions, schemas and performance tuning and quality assurance
  • Good experience working with Azure Data Factory or SQL Server Integration Services
  • Experience with Scala is a bonus
View Job  Cape Town: Audit Senior posted by Hire Resolve

Benefits 

  • Salary: R960K/yr – R1.44M/yr, salary negotiable
  • Family Leave (Maternity, Paternity) 
  • Training & Development 
  • Hybrid Schedule 

If you meet the above requirements and want to make a career-changing move, apply today by either filling in the online application form or emailing your CV to Hire Resolve at 

You are also welcome to contact Gine Gebhardt on LinkedIn or call them on 

Please note that correspondence will only be conducted with shortlisted candidates for this position. Should you not hear from us within 3 days, please consider your application unsuccessful. 

Job Seeker Tip

Network actively - many jobs are filled through referrals before being advertised.

Click Go Apply to apply online!

Apply directly for this position. Please read all instructions carefully.

We do not process job applications; we simply aggregate and display job listings.

More related positions


Bellville: Senior Python Developer posted by Kontak Recruitment

Senior Python Developer (Django) (JB5138) Bellville, Cape Town (Hybrid)R80 000 - R100 000 CTC per monthPermanent An exciting opportunity awaits an experienced Senior Python Developer to lead the modernization of an insurance platform. This role involves d


View Job
Senior Python Developer

Cape Town: Senior Software Engineer (Python) (Remote) posted by Datafin

Senior Software Engineer (Python) (Remote)IT - Software Development
Cape Town - Western Cape - South Africa
ENVIRONMENT:
A leading online retailer in South Africa is seeking an Interm


View Job
Senior Software Engineer (Python) (Remote)

Western Cape: Senior Python Developer posted by Network Finance

We are looking for a talented and experienced Senior Python Developer to join a dynamic team in Cape Town. As a key member of the engineering team, you will play a pivotal role in designing, developing, and maintaining cutting-edge f

View Job  Johannesburg: Credit Controller posted by Hire Resolve

View Job
Senior Python Developer

Gauteng: Senior Backend Engineer (Python) (Remote) posted by Datafin

Senior Backend Engineer (Python) (Remote)IT - Software Development
KwaZulu Natal - South Africa, Gauteng - South Africa, Western Cape - South Africa, Remote

Johannesburg: Senior Python Developer posted by Sabenza IT & Recruitment

We are seeking a highly motivated Senior Python Backend Engineer with a strong understanding of serverless architecture to join our growing team. Reporting to the Product Owner and Chapter


View Job
Senior Python Developer

Cape Town: Senior Full Stack Software Engineer (Angular, Python, Django) (CPT Hybrid) posted by Datafin

Senior Full Stack Software Engineer (Angular, Python, Django) (CPT Hybrid)IT - Software Development
Cape Town - Western Cape - South Africa

Cape Town: Senior Backend Developer (Python, SQL, NoSQL) posted by Datafin

Senior Backend Developer (Python, SQL, NoSQL)IT - Software Development
Cape Town - Western Cape - South Africa
ENVIRONMENT:
LEAD the development of scalable, high-performance analytics


View Job
Senior Backend Developer (Python, SQL, NoSQL)

Cape Town: Senior Python Developer posted by Hire Resolve

Our client in the Digital Insurance Industry is searching for an experienced Senior Python Developer to join their team in Cape Town on a hybrid work model.

Senior Python Developer responsibilities include participating in all phases of the softw


View Job
Senior Python Developer

Cape Town: Senior Python Developer posted by Hire Resolve

Our client is seeking a Senior Python Developer to join their team on a hybrid model in their offices based in Cape Town.

View Job  Midrand: JUNIOR Dispatch/collections clerk (AFRIKAANS) posted by Curiska

Requirements:


Cape Town: Senior Python Developer – Software Development – R1.44M – R960K posted by Hire Resolve

Hire Resolves client is urgently seeking the expertise of a Senior Python Developer in Cape Town (Hybrid)

 

Responsibilities


Cape Town: Senior Python Developer – Finance Industry – R1Mil posted by Hire Resolve

Hire Resolves client is urgently seeking the expertise of an experienced Senior Python Developer in Cape Town (Hybrid).

Responsibilities


South Africa: Senior Backend Developer (Python, Sql, Nosql)

ENVIRONMENT: LEAD the development of scalable, high-performance analytics services tailored for a Procurement Marketplace as the next Senior Backend Developer sought by a cutting-edge Finance Platform. Youll be at the heart of data-driven decision-making


View Job
Senior Backend Developer (Python, Sql, Nosql)

Johannesburg: Senior Python Backend Engineer (Jhb/Cpt)

The role of the Serverless Backend Engineer is responsible for understanding requirements and building solutions under a serverless architecture model. The Serverless Backend Engineer reports directly to the Product Owner and the Chapter Leader. Build so


View Job
Senior Python Backend Engineer (Jhb/Cpt)

Error making API request: cURL error 6: Could not resolve host: publisher.resgen.us
Share this to someone who needs a job:
Posted in Jobs in Cape Town, Jobs in South Africa, Jobs in Western Cape

More Jobs in Your Area